Latest Revision
Kurt Garloff's avatar Kurt Garloff (garloff) committed (revision 4)
- We cannot update from fdupes 1.51 to 1.6.1. That "downgrade"
  works okay'ish for Tumbleweed because we can replace the old
  package with the new one, but in SLE this is not possible. We
  asked upstream to please release a "2.0" version to remedy these
  issues (https://github.com/adrianlopezroche/fdupes/issues/74),
  but he does not respond. Therefore, we'll call this version 1.61,
  ignoring upstreams change in the versioning scheme.

- Upstream has changed their versioning scheme after version 1.51.
  Unfortunately, the new version 1.6.x won't be recognized as
  "newer" by zypper. This commit adds appropriate "provides" and
  "obsoletes" attributes to the spec file to remedy that issue.

- Drop 50_bts284274_hardlinkreplace.dpatch. The --linkhard option
  added by this patch has an implementation bug that can cause data
  loss. https://bugs.debian.org/cgi-bin/bugreport.cgi?bug=677419
  has more details.
